Top Innovations in Energy Storage Container Power Station Companies
Why Energy Storage Containers Are Reshaping Power Solutions
In today's energy landscape, energy storage container power station companies are leading the charge toward flexible, scalable power solutions. These modular systems—often called "plug-and-play power hubs"—combine cutting-edge battery tech with smart management software. Think of them as Lego blocks for energy: stackable, movable, and adaptable to industries from solar farms to factories.
Who Needs These Systems? Target Markets Unpacked
- Renewable Energy Providers: Solar and wind farms use containers to store excess energy, smoothing out supply fluctuations.
- Manufacturing Plants: Factories deploy them for peak shaving, reducing electricity bills during high-demand hours.
- Remote Communities: Off-grid towns rely on containerized systems as primary power sources.
Key Trends Driving the Industry
1. The Rise of 20-Foot "BESS-in-a-Box" Designs
Most modern systems fit into standard shipping containers (20ft or 40ft), slashing installation time by 60% compared to traditional setups. A 2024 report shows containerized Battery Energy Storage Systems (BESS) now account for 38% of new grid-scale projects globally.
Year | Market Share | Average Capacity |
---|---|---|
2023 | 29% | 2.4 MWh |
2024 | 38% | 3.1 MWh |
2025* | 47%* | 4.0 MWh* |
*Projected data from Energy Storage Insights
2. Liquid Cooling Takes Over
Air-cooled systems? They're so 2020. Today's leaders use liquid thermal management, boosting efficiency by 15-20% and extending battery life. One mining company in Australia cut energy waste by 18% after upgrading to liquid-cooled containers.
What Makes a Reliable Provider?
- Safety Certifications: UL9540 and IEC62619 compliance are non-negotiables.
- Cycle Life Guarantees: Top-tier systems promise 6,000+ cycles at 80% capacity retention.
- Scalability: Can units be paralleled for 100MWh+ projects? If not, keep looking.
Case Study: Solar + Storage in California
A 50MW solar farm paired with 12 containerized BESS units reduced curtailment losses by $2.7 million annually. The containers' NEMA 4X-rated enclosures withstood desert sandstorms—no performance dips.

FAQ
Q: How long do these containers last?
A: Most systems operate efficiently for 10-15 years, depending on usage cycles and maintenance.
Q: Can they withstand extreme temperatures?
A: Yes—advanced thermal controls maintain performance from -22°F to 122°F (-30°C to 50°C).
Q: What's the payback period for commercial users?
A: Typically 3-5 years when used for peak shaving or demand charge reduction.
